Can mold mildew remover products be used for serious mold issues here?

While some mold mildew remover products might handle very small surface spots, they're not a solution for significant mold problems in Anchorage. Larger infestations require professional intervention. The crew that comes out has specialized equipment and knowledge to safely remove and contain mold without spreading spores. Relying on DIY products for extensive mold can actually make the problem worse and more costly to fix later.

What does mold testing involve for Anchorage homes?

Mold testing for Anchorage homes typically involves visual inspections and air sampling. A specialist will look for visible mold growth and signs of past moisture issues. They might also collect air samples from different areas of your home to measure the concentration of mold spores. This helps determine the extent of the problem and guides the remediation plan. It's a crucial step for a comprehensive solution.
